A senior judge working with Nepal\'s highest court - Supreme Court - was shot dead by unidentified assailants in the country\'s capital Kathmandu, the Press Trust of India (PTI) reported Thursday. Two motorcycle borne assailants followed the judge Rana Bahadur Bam who was travelling in car, and fired at him from close range through the car\'s window. According to the report, a pamphlet of an unheard group \"Nepalbad Party\" was found at the scene of the crime, which said that this action was taken \"against corruption in the judiciary\". The deceased had received gun-shots in his head and chest, and was declared brought dead by a local hospital. According to the report, no arrests have been made so far. The judge\'s bodyguard has been injured but his driver escaped unhurt.
